Structures of the helmets:
This bulletproof helmet consists of a helmet shell chin strap and a helmet top suspension system. It's lightweight and can be used with noise-canceling headphones. The inside of the bulletproof helmet has an adjustable system, which is comfortable and has strong cushioning function. There are attached rails on the outside of the helmet for expansion of equipment.
It is resistant to corrosion by various chemicals, ultraviolet light, waterproof, and bulletproof. It has excellent adaptability to night vision devices, gas masks, etc., and has high product quality and batch consistency.
Protection level: GA293-2012 "Police Bulletproof Helmets and Masks" Level 3 (that is, resistant to Type 51 7.62mm pistol bullets (lead core) fired from Type 54 pistols. It has passed the test of the China Ordnance Industry Bulletproof Equipment Quality Supervision and Inspection Center.
Bulletproof performance: Under normal temperature conditions, with a shooting distance of 5m, a Type 79 7.62mm light submachine gun was used with a Type 51 7.62mm pistol bullet. There were 5 effective projectiles, none of which penetrated.

What can a bulletproof helmet stop?
Generally, modern ballistic helmets, including those used by the military, are made with Aramid fibers and are hence only rated to stop pistol calibers. Most ballistic helmets you find on the market will be rated at level IIIA. This means they are rated to stop up to a . 44 Magnum at point-blank range.
How do bulletproof helmets work?
Ballistic helmets are typically made from Kevlar® or aramid, the same material that is in bulletproof vests. This high-grade composite material forms the core of many modern helmets. Kevlar fibers are woven into multiple layers to create a composite capable of absorbing and dispersing the energy of a ballistic impact.
